Humane Society of Huron Valley Presents - Spring Adopt-a-thon, April 28, 2012

Ann Arbor, MI.   The Humane Society of Huron Valley (HSHV) is excited to announce our first ever Spring Adopt-a-thon to be held on Saturday, April 28, 2012 at HSHV.

HSHV will be open from 9 a.m. to midnight during this mega-adoption event.

"This time of the year is when our facility reaches capacity as kittens start entering in large quantities. In order to make room for all the other homeless pets that need shelter, we are hoping to find new forever homes for 150 pets in this one single day," said Deb Kern, HSHV Marketing Director. "Besides all of our animals, there will also be additional pets here from selected rescues looking for homes as well."

We do require a dog-to-dog interaction if you want to adopt a dog an already have dog(s) at home. If it is not convenient for you to visit and then return home to get your dog, please do bring them with you. The forecast is calling for mid 40’s on Saturday so pets should be safe for a period of time with the windows cracked. Please do inform our staff that your dog is with you in the car and we will do our best to facilitate a timely interaction if you find a dog you’d wish to adopt. Thank you.
